Protein crystallography data

The structure of Crystal Structure of the Complex of M. Tuberculosis Phers with Cognate Precursor Trna and 5'-O-(N-Phenylalanyl)Sulfamoyl-Adenosine, PDB code: 7k9m was solved by K.Michalska, C.Chang, R.Jedrzejczak, J.Wower, B.Baragana, B.Forte, I.H.Gilbert, A.Joachimiak, Center For Structural Genomics Ofinfectious Diseases (Csgid), with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 47.92 / 2.50
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 128.432, 110.753, 147.897, 90, 103.59, 90
R / Rfree (%) 17.9 / 21.5
